In this entry, we will closely examine the discrete fourier transform in excel aka dft and its inverse, as well as data filtering using dft outputs. Much of this material is a straightforward generalization of the 1d fourier analysis with which you are familiar. In this tutorial, we consider working out fourier series for functions fx with period l 2 their fundamental frequency is then k 2. Note, for a full discussion of the fourier series and fourier transform that are the foundation of the dft and fft, see the superposition principle, fourier series, fourier transform tutorial. Fourier transforms and convolution stanford university. Chapter 1 the fourier transform math user home pages. Es 442 fourier transform 2 summary of lecture 3 page 1 for a linear timeinvariant network, given input xt, the output yt xt ht, where ht is the unit impulse response of the network in the time domain. Fourier series, continuous fourier transform, discrete fourier transform, and discrete time fourier transform are some of the variants of fourier analysis. The most commonly used set of orthogonal functions is the fourier series. A brief introduction to the fourier transform this document is an introduction to the fourier transform. An algorithm for the machine calculation of complex fourier series. The fourier transform ft decomposes a function of time a signal into the frequencies that make it up, in a way similar to how a musical chord can be expressed as the frequencies or pitches of its constituent notes.
We have also seen that complex exponentials may be used in place of sins and coss. These representations can be used to both synthesize a variety of. Fast fourier transform fourier series introduction fourier series are used in the analysis of periodic functions. Abstract in digital signal processing dsp, the fast fourier transform fft is one of the most fundamental and useful system building block available to the designer. Transition is the appropriate word, for in the approach well take the fourier transform emerges as we pass from periodic to nonperiodic functions. Hilbert transform, shorttime fourier transform more about this later, wigner distributions, the radon transform, and of course our featured transformation, the wavelet transform, constitute only a small portion of a huge list of transforms that are available at engineers and mathematicians disposal. Evaluating fourier transforms with matlab in class we study the analytic approach for determining the fourier transform of a continuous time signal. For a general real function, the fourier transform will have both real and imaginary parts. An interactive guide to the fourier transform betterexplained.
Fourier transform has many applications in physics and engineering such as analysis of lti systems, radar, astronomy, signal processing etc. L 1, and their fourier series representations involve terms like a 1 cosx, b 1 sinx a 2 cos2x, b 2 sin2x a 3 cos3x, b 3 sin3x we also include a constant term a 02 in the fourier series. This includes using the symbol i for the square root of minus one. The purpose of these tutorials is to demonstrate how restrictive this interpretation of frequency can be in some pdf fast. Derive the fourier transform of the signals ft shown in fig. Computational fourier optics is a text that shows the reader in a tutorial form how to implement fourier optical theory and analytic methods on the computer.
A fourier transform converts a wave in the time domain to the frequency domain. William slade abstract in digital signal processing dsp, the fast fourier transform fft is one of the most fundamental and useful. Fourier series can be generalized to complex numbers, and further generalized to derive the fourier transform. The domain of integration gray regions for the fourier transform of the autocorrelation eq.
Fourier cosine series for even functions and sine series for odd functions the continuous limit. Es 442 fourier transform 2 summary of lecture 3 page 1 for a linear timeinvariant network, given input xt, the output yt xt ht, where ht is the unit impulse response of. Fourier analysis converts a signal from its original domain often time or space to a representation in the frequency domain and vice versa. A fast fourier transform fft is an algorithm that computes the discrete fourier transform dft of a sequence, or its inverse idft. What if any signal could be filtered into a bunch of circular paths. Fast fourier transform tutorial fast fourier transform fft is a tool to decompose any deterministic or nondeterministic signal into its constituent frequencies, from which one can extract very useful information about the system under investigation that is most of the time unavailable otherwise. This concept is mindblowing, and poor joseph fourier had his idea rejected at first. Lecture notes for the fourier transform and its applications. During the preparation of this tutorial, i found that almost all the textbooks on digital image processing have a section devoted to the fourier theory. An introduction to fourier analysis fourier series, partial di. Great listed sites have fourier series pdf tutorial. Fourier transforms and the fast fourier transform fft algorithm.
Fourier transforms and the fast fourier transform fft. The fast fourier transform fft algorithm the fft is a fast algorithm for computing the dft. Inverse fourier transform maps the series of frequencies their amplitudes and phases back into the corresponding time series. Chapter 1 the fourier transform university of minnesota. A primary objective is to give students of fourier optics the capability of programming their own basic wave. The complex or infinite fourier transform of fx is given by. When you learned calculus it was necessary to learn the derivative and integral formulas for. The quantum fourier transform can be either simulated on a classical computer or performed on a quantum computer as its efficiencies are derived from the innate properties of quantum computing. I to nd a fourier series, it is su cient to calculate the integrals that give the coe cients a 0, a n, and b nand plug them in to the big series formula, equation 2. Fourier transform of a function is a summation of sine and cosine terms of differ ent frequency. On completion of this tutorial, you should be able to do the following.
The dft of a sequence is defined as equation 11 where n is the transform size and. The discrete fourier transform dft is the family member used with digitized signals. The fourier transform of a pure fourier mode will always just be a and its pdf is a fourier transform anyway, you need a side tutorial to explain how vector, limitations of the fourier transform. We then generalise that discussion to consider the fourier transform.
We have also seen that complex exponentials may be. For the love of physics walter lewin may 16, 2011 duration. Fast fourier transform the faculty of mathematics and. Fourier space or frequency space note that in a computer, we can represent a function as an array of numbers giving the values of that function at equally spaced points. Really joe, even a staircase pattern can be made from circles. Were about to make the transition from fourier series to the fourier transform. That is why in signal processing, the fourier analysis is applied in frequency or spectrum analysis. A primary objective is to give students of fourier optics the capability of programming their own basic wave optic beam propagations and imaging simulations. One hardly ever uses fourier sine and cosine transforms. If we take the 2point dft and 4point dft and generalize them to 8point, 16point. Jan 19, 20 for the love of physics walter lewin may 16, 2011 duration.
The fourier transform is a way for us to take the combined wave, and get each of the sine waves back out. The fourier transform is crucial to any discussion of time series analysis, and this. Great listed sites have fourier transform tutorial pdf. Chapter 5 discrete fourier transform dft page 1 chapter 5 discrete fourier transform, dft and fft in the previous chapters we learned about fourier series and the fourier transform. Jun 17, 2019 that is why in signal processing, the fourier analysis is applied in frequency or spectrum analysis.
Introduction to fourier transform watch more videos at lecture by. The fourier transform the fourier transform is crucial to any discussion of time series analysis, and this chapter discusses the definition of the transform and begins introducing some of the ways it is useful. Using matlab to plot the fourier transform of a time function. Like continuous time signal fourier transform, discrete time fourier transform can be used to represent a discrete sequence into its equivalent frequency domain representation and lti discrete time system and develop various computational algorithms. Fourier transform in excel discrete fourier transform tutorial. The inverse fourier transform maps in the other direction it turns out that the fourier transform and inverse fourier transform are almost identical. The level is intended for physics undergraduates in their 2nd or 3rd year of studies. If we carry on to n d8, n d16, and other poweroftwo discrete fourier transforms, we get. In this entry, we will closely examine the discrete fourier transform in excel aka dft and. In other words, any space or time varying data can be transformed into a different.
Overview the fft is a computationally efficient algorith m for computing a discrete fourier transform dft of sample sizes that are a positive integer power of 2. The purpose of these tutorials is to demonstrate how restrictive this interpretation of frequency can be in some pdf. First and foremost, the integrals in question as in any integral transform must exist, and be. In this example, you can almost do it in your head, just by. The basics fourier series examples fourier series remarks. A tutorial on fourier analysis 0 20 40 60 80 100 120 140 160 180 20010. Fourier cosine series for even functions and sine series for odd functions. Obrien as we will see in the next section, the fourier transform is developed from the fourier integral, so it shares many properties of the former. I big advantage that fourier series have over taylor series. Digital signal processing dft introduction tutorialspoint. First and foremost, the integrals in question as in. Graphically, even functions have symmetry about the yaxis, whereas odd functions have symmetry around the origin. A tutorial on fourier analysis fourier series gaussianwaves. Fast fourier transform tutorial fast fourier transform fft is a tool to decompose any deterministic or nondeterministic signal into its constituent frequencies, from which one can extract very useful information about the system under investigation that is most.
This is the first of four chapters on the real dft, a version of the discrete fourier transform that uses real numbers. Fourier transform fourier transform maps a time series eg audio samples into the series of frequencies their amplitudes and phases that composed the time series. The fourier transform conversion between time and frequency domains time domain frequency domain fourier transform displacement of air concert a eric price tutorial on sparse fourier transforms 2 27. Fourier transforms and the fast fourier transform fft algorithm paul heckbert feb. Then the function fx is the inverse fourier transform of fs and is given by. Let be the continuous signal which is the source of the data. In elementary school, children learn that multiplication of scalars may be. Most of those describe some formulas and algorithms, but one can easily be lost in seemingly incomprehensible. Fourier transform stanford engineering stanford university. There are many applications for the fourier transform, particularly in the fields of mathematics and physics. Define fourier transform pair or define fourier transform and its inverse transform. Dtft is not suitable for dsp applications because in dsp, we are able to compute the spectrum only at speci. This is the first tutorial in our ongoing series on time series spectral analysis.
Fourier analysis and power spectral density figure 4. This document is an introduction to the fourier transform. Schoenstadt department of applied mathematics naval postgraduate school code mazh monterey, california 93943 august 18, 2005 c 1992 professor arthur l. Lecture notes for thefourier transform and applications. Introduction to the fourier transform part 2 youtube.
1403 984 1565 1059 892 1159 696 983 334 495 1089 1546 1462 451 157 1075 931 1387 702 550 805 768 1238 643 320 836 1111 1416 228 304 20 1329 1020 808 1448 526